Sure, but people were surprised in episode 3. And then again in episode 7. In literally the first seconds you can feel something off. Plus even the happy parts have something sinister waning above them. And QB is maybe a hit to creepy designed, its just too obvious even with the cute voice.
Once the show got started, for sure. I just think a lot of that (even throughout the series) had to go with the way they set up expectations before slapping it on good. I felt like it was a lot different when it was airing (and we were all none the wiser). Nobody was really able to predict anything (outside of the general tone once it got going), and it made for a fun sense of community at the time.
A lot of it has to do with the expanded audience it attracted though, too. It reached a lot more mainstream than many expected.
I'm guessing people didn't check who wrote Madoka. If your familiar with Urobuchi then you know he is going to kill off characters.

I made a post here and in the Poster thread about trying to get together a bunch of people interested in doing a commission for an Aria poster: http://www.neogaf.com/forum/showpost.php?p=112894246&postcount=15414
Ultimately I'm not sure if there's enough interest in either the actual project or perhaps the property, but since I've got 7 interested people from AnimeGAF already, I thought I'd just post this a second time to see if anyone else might be interested.
Essentially, I'd like to do a poster commission for a piece based on some aspect of Aria. Everything would be decided by the group of people who would want in on the poster, including the artist, what the poster would look like, and so on, but for reference I would hope it would come out like this album art:
http://i.imgur.com/HRgd9Cpl.jpg
So, something with the main characters with some aspect of Venice/Neo Venezia in the background.
So why Aria? New members of AnimeGAF may not know, but Aria is one of my favourite anime and television shows. Through a science fiction utopian world view, Aria tells a heartwarming slice of life story that celebrates human life through the small wonders that are littered throughout our everyday lives. Having a piece of Aria art would hopefully capture some aspect of that magic, giving people a small window into a sentimental world full of joie de vivre. I know it'd probably be much easier to just take a page out of Amano's manga or art book and then just blow that up to poster size, but making this poster happen with other fans of Aria or anime would make that window something unique to our little shared community.
As I mentioned, we have 7 people interested - pretty much all of the Aria fans that I know of, but Mockingbird suggested that we need about 15 people to make the commission viable, so we're about half way there in terms of people who want in on the project.
I'm not sure how much each poster would cost - I assume it depends ultimately on which artist is chosen, how big the poster ends up being, whether it is in colour or not, but the Kiki poster that Mockingbird did a while ago cost 40 dollars or so... so I'm guessing that's the ballpark figure.
Mockingbird has also kindly offered to handle the logistics of the project if it goes forward, and I'm grateful because he clearly has the experience with speaking to artists and getting all the printing and shipping done (I appreciated his expert packaging of the posters to protect them in transit!).
If you are interested, feel free to PM me and reply to this post.
Thanks!
